Frequently Asked Questions

How many students attend Newtown Preschool At Ris?
30 students attend Newtown Preschool At Ris.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
87% of Newtown Preschool At Ris students are White, 10% of students are Hispanic, and 3% of students are Asian.
What school district is Newtown Preschool At Ris part of?
Newtown Preschool At Ris is part of Newtown School District.
